Because that's the laws of physics. Heat doesn't equal impact, a thin copper wire can withstand a 500 C fire without melting or even turning red. But I can easily snap that same wire with relative ease, while that same flame can leave me with painful burns. An object's heat resistance doesn't correlate to durability against impacts.Todoroki's feats are their own thing since we apparently can't scale anyone to his ice or fire.

However without it they're basically worthless, since 7-C fire doesn't tell me how hot it is. And 7-C heat resistance makes zero sense.
Since a fire that is 1000 degree but covers a multiple city blocks, will have a higher energy/"AP" value than a 5000 degree flame that only covers a person's body or a small room at best. But the energy value isn't what causes melting or heat damage, it is the temperature of the flame/object.
So having 7-C resistance against heat doesn't tell me anything, I've been meaning to make a thread about this but I'm lazy and I'm not certain this wiki even knows how to handle heat/temperature feats in general.
